excel公式计算怎么保留两位小数的
作者:excel百科网
|
96人看过
发布时间:2026-03-08 01:43:33
在Excel中,若需通过公式计算保留两位小数,核心方法是结合四舍五入函数或设置单元格格式,确保计算结果既精确又整洁,这能有效提升数据可读性与规范性,满足日常报表或财务处理需求,本文将从多个层面详细解析如何实现这一目标。
在数据处理与分析的日常工作中,许多用户会遇到一个看似简单却十分关键的问题:excel公式计算怎么保留两位小数的?这不仅是数字格式的美观需求,更是确保数据准确性、规范性的基础要求,尤其是涉及财务统计、科学计算或商业报告时,保留两位小数能避免因四舍五入不当引发的误差,接下来,我们将深入探讨多种方法,帮助您灵活应对不同场景。 理解保留两位小数的本质 在Excel中,保留两位小数并非直接修改原始数值,而是通过格式调整或函数控制显示与计算结果,这分为两种情况:一是仅改变单元格外观,让数字显示为两位小数,但实际值可能包含更多位数;二是真正将数值四舍五入到两位小数,后续计算基于此进行,区分这两种情况至关重要,因为前者适用于展示,后者适用于精确运算。 使用四舍五入函数实现精确保留 最直接的方法是借助四舍五入函数,例如,假设A1单元格存放原始数据,您可以在B1输入公式:=ROUND(A1,2),这会将A1的值四舍五入到两位小数,并返回结果,类似的函数还有ROUNDUP和ROUNDDOWN,分别用于向上或向下舍入,若需处理大量数据,可将公式向下填充,确保整列数据统一规范。 设置单元格格式进行视觉调整 如果仅需美化显示,无需改变实际值,可选中目标单元格,右键点击“设置单元格格式”,在“数字”选项卡中选择“数值”,并将小数位数设为2,这样,即使单元格内是3.1415926,也会显示为3.14,但公式引用时仍使用原始值,此方法适合报表输出,避免因舍入误差影响中间计算。 结合文本函数固定小数位数 对于需要将结果转为文本的场景,例如生成标签或导出特定格式,可使用TEXT函数,公式如:=TEXT(A1,"0.00"),这会将数值转换为两位小数的文本格式,但需注意,转换后无法直接用于数值计算,通常用于最终呈现或与其他文本拼接。 利用自定义格式增强灵活性 在设置单元格格式时,选择“自定义”并输入格式代码,例如“0.00”,可强制显示两位小数,即使整数也会补零,如5显示为5.00,若想隐藏零值,可用“0.00;-0.00;”,这为不同数据状态提供了定制化显示方案。 处理求和与平均值计算中的小数保留 当使用SUM或AVERAGE等函数时,若希望结果直接保留两位小数,可在公式外嵌套ROUND函数,例如:=ROUND(SUM(A1:A10),2),这能避免先求和再手动调整的繁琐,确保计算一步到位,尤其适用于财务累计或统计摘要。 应对浮点数计算误差的策略 计算机浮点数运算可能产生微小误差,如0.1+0.2结果非精确0.3,此时若直接保留两位小数,可能显示异常,建议先用ROUND函数处理参与计算的每个数值,或设置Excel选项中的“以显示精度为准”,但这会全局改变计算方式,需谨慎使用。 在条件格式中应用小数保留 若需根据数值大小进行高亮显示,可结合条件格式与小数保留,例如,设置规则为“单元格值大于等于10.00”,即使原始数据多出小数位,格式也能正确触发,这增强了数据可视化的准确性。 使用固定函数处理负数舍入 对于负数舍入,ROUND函数遵循标准四舍五入规则,但若需特殊处理,如始终向绝对值大的方向舍入,需自定义公式,例如结合ABS和SIGN函数调整,确保商业逻辑一致。 嵌套函数实现复杂舍入需求 在某些场景下,需根据条件动态保留小数,例如,数值大于100时保留一位,否则保留两位,可使用IF函数嵌套:=IF(A1>100,ROUND(A1,1),ROUND(A1,2)),这展现了公式的灵活性与强大功能。 借助分析工具库进行高级舍入 若安装了分析工具库,可使用MROUND函数按指定倍数舍入,例如=MROUND(A1,0.05)将数值舍入到最接近的0.05倍数,适合货币或计量单位转换,扩展了保留小数的应用范围。 批量操作与自动化技巧 对于大量数据,可录制宏或使用Power Query进行批量小数保留,在Power Query中,转换列时选择“舍入”并设置小数位数,能高效处理整个数据集,适合定期报告生成。 检查与验证舍入结果 完成舍入后,建议用公式核对,例如用=ABS(ROUND(A1,2)-A1)检查误差是否在允许范围内,或使用审核工具追踪计算步骤,确保数据完整性,避免隐藏错误。 结合图表展示保留小数的数据 将保留两位小数的数据用于图表时,需确保坐标轴或数据标签格式同步,可在图表设置中调整数字格式为“0.00”,使可视化呈现更专业清晰。 常见错误与避免方法 新手常犯的错误包括混淆显示与计算舍入,或在公式中多次舍入导致精度损失,建议统一舍入阶段,并文档化处理逻辑,以便团队协作与后续维护。 实际应用场景示例 假设您在处理销售报表,需要计算折扣后价格并保留两位小数,可在价格列使用公式:=ROUND(原价折扣率,2),然后设置单元格格式为货币,这样既保证计算准确,又符合财务规范,类似地,对于科学实验数据,可用ROUND结合平均值计算,提升报告可信度。 总结与最佳实践建议 总之,掌握Excel公式计算怎么保留两位小数的方法,能显著提升工作效率与数据质量,关键是根据需求选择合适方案:若需精确计算,优先使用ROUND类函数;若仅需美化,调整单元格格式即可,同时,注意浮点数误差并定期验证结果,将这些技巧融入日常操作,您的数据处理能力将更加游刃有余。
推荐文章
用户询问“excel公式计算过程”,其核心需求是希望系统地理解并掌握在Excel(电子表格)中,从公式的输入、构成元素、运算逻辑到错误排查的完整工作流程与底层原理,从而能够自主构建和优化计算公式来解决实际数据处理问题。
2026-03-08 01:42:31
215人看过
自学Excel公式的最简单方法是遵循“从核心概念入手,结合明确目标进行阶梯式练习,并善用交互式免费资源”的系统路径,这能帮助学习者高效克服畏难情绪,快速建立实用技能。
2026-03-08 01:40:55
155人看过
当Excel公式显示乱码或意外变为0时,通常是由于数据格式错误、引用问题、计算设置或外部数据源异常所致。要解决“excel公式乱码变为0”,您需要系统检查单元格格式、公式语法、计算选项以及文件兼容性,并通过分步排查恢复公式的正常计算与显示。
2026-03-08 00:49:16
229人看过
当您确信自己输入的Excel公式完全正确,但表格却顽固地显示错误时,这通常不是公式逻辑的问题,而是由单元格格式、计算设置、数据源引用或软件环境等“看不见”的因素导致的。要解决“excel公式是对的但是显示错误怎么回事儿”这一难题,核心在于系统性地排查这些潜在干扰项,例如检查数字是否被存储为文本、公式是否被意外转换为文本格式、计算选项是否设置为手动等,本文将为您梳理十二个常见原因并提供详细的解决方案。
2026-03-08 00:47:54
119人看过
.webp)

.webp)
